Comprehending the Causes of Foggy Windows
Foggy windows are primarily triggered by moisture getting caught in between the panes of double-glazed windows. This problem is often a result of sealant failure. Below are essential elements that can contribute to foggy windows:
Seal Failure: The most typical reason for foggy windows. The sealant that holds the insulated glass panes together can use down gradually.Temperature Changes: Rapid temperature level variations can warp window frames and cause seals to break.Age of the Window: Older windows are more prone to moisture accumulation due to use and tear.Incorrect Installation: Poor window setup can cause misalignment and seal failure.Repairing Foggy Windows
Repairing foggy windows can differ from DIY services to professional services. Below is a comprehensive take a look at different repair options:
1. DIY Solutions to Foggy Windows
If the fogging is moderate, property owners might consider the following DIY approaches:
A. Desiccant Packs
These packs soak up wetness and can often be placed in between the panes if there is a gain access to point.
B. Use a Hairdryer
Gently heating up the glass can evaporate the moisture. This is a short-lived service and ought to be used with care.
C. Sealant Resealing
For older windows, resealing might be necessary. Clear the area of old sealant and apply a fresh bead to prevent more moisture entry.
2. Professional Services
For more extensive fogging, professional services might be required. Here are some typical treatments:
A. Glass Replacement
In severe cases, changing the whole window system may be the most efficient option.
B. Window Defogging Services
Certain companies concentrate on eliminating fog in between glass panes without the need to change the whole window.
C. Full Window Replacement
If the windows are too old or damaged, consider a complete replacement for improved performance and aesthetic appeals.

A: Many foggy windows can be fixed. Solutions vary from DIY approaches to professional defogging services. Nevertheless, if the window is seriously harmed, a replacement may be more prudent.
Q2: How much does it usually cost to repair foggy windows?
A: DIY repairs can be provided for under ₤ 50, while professional services can range from ₤ 100 to over ₤ 500 depending upon the degree of the fogging and required repairs.
Q3: Is a window defogging service worth it?
A: Yes, if done by experts, window defogging can bring back presence and extend the life of your windows without the requirement for complete replacement.
Q4: How can I prevent windows from fogging in the first place?
A: Regular maintenance, buying quality windows, keeping humidity levels steady, and making sure appropriate setup can all help prevent fogging.
Q5: Will my homeowner's insurance coverage cover foggy window repair?
A: It depends on the policy. Some might cover window repairs due to seal failure or storm damage but contact your insurance company for specifics.
